These seedlings are grown from seed in air-pruning nursery beds at White Oak Orchard in Trenton, South Carolina. Air-pruning encourages dense, fibrous root systems instead of circling roots, helping improve transplant success, establishment, and long-term growth once planted.

Best Planting Sites

Pecan trees perform best in full sun and deep, fertile, well-drained soil. They are best suited for open areas, orchard-style plantings, field edges, bottomland sites with good drainage, and larger wildlife plantings.

Avoid planting pecans in tight shade or areas with poor drainage. Young trees benefit from weed control, protection from deer browse, and consistent moisture during establishment.

Shipping Information

Seedlings are shipped bare-root while dormant.

·         Fall Shipping: Late November to mid-December, based on USDA Zone and availability

·         Spring Shipping: Mid-December to mid-April, based on USDA Zone and availability

For best survival, plant as soon as possible after receiving your seedlings, keep roots moist until planting, and protect young trees from deer browse and competing weeds.
